Prisma SD-WAN and Zscaler Zero Trust Exchange Platform are key contenders in network management and security solutions. Prisma SD-WAN may have an edge with its advanced traffic management features and cloud integration, but Zscaler stands out for its strong security features and ease of use.
Features: Prisma SD-WAN offers advanced traffic management, zero-touch provisioning, and cloud integration. It enhances network environments with its ability to prioritize packets using Layer 7 intelligence, providing deep application visibility. Zscaler is known for robust data protection and the ability to seamlessly integrate with existing VPNs, featuring API integration, SSL inspection, and a single sign-on solution for convenient connectivity.
Room for Improvement: Prisma SD-WAN needs better alert communication and more comprehensive documentation. Users also desire enhanced failover responsiveness and increased training resources. Zscaler’s user interface could benefit from greater intuitiveness, improved latency, and more flexible detection mechanisms. Users also request static IP address assignment for compatibility with legacy systems.
Ease of Deployment and Customer Service: Both solutions offer cloud deployment options. However, users report that Prisma SD-WAN is somewhat complex during setup, requiring supportive resources. Its technical support is efficient but could be faster. Zscaler's pricing model is well-defined with competitive tiered licensing. Its clear ROI, despite being costlier than Prisma, is noted for offering value through ease of integration.
Pricing and ROI: Prisma SD-WAN is a premium solution with considerable upfront costs but delivers ROI by reducing network outages and fostering efficient management. While identified as costly, its advanced features are viewed as justifying the expense. Zscaler is cost-efficient with user-based pricing, recognized for suitability for larger organizations. Both provide ROI, addressing diverse budget needs and network scales.

Iboss offers a comprehensive cloud-based security platform valued for its scalability and autonomous features, ensuring robust security with easy deployment and management capabilities.
Renowned for its robust security architecture, Iboss integrates seamlessly within diverse networks, delivering efficient granular filtering and advanced content categorization. Its single pane of glass console provides ease of management, allowing rapid scalability suitable for rapidly deploying environments. Operates in BYOD setups due to inline filtering without device installation. Integration with cloud-based applications enhances user control, and features like SASE, SSL inspection, and ChatGPT risk protection stand as highlights. Despite its strengths, users have pointed out areas for enhancement like direct navigation in reports, SSL decryption, and better cloud integration while having room to improve data loss prevention.
What are the most important features of Iboss?The usage of Iboss spans educational institutions, specifically K-12, to enforce internet policies, protect data, and support remote work environments. It provides web filtering and security frameworks to ensure safe browsing. Its platform-as-a-service model offers flexibility for both cloud-based and on-premises requirements, integrating seamlessly to deliver enhanced security features suitable for various deployment needs including zero trust, CASB, and network security for work-from-home setups.

Zscaler Zero Trust Exchange enhances security with seamless cloud-based connectivity and VPN-less operation, offering integration with multiple identity providers and advanced security features, suitable for remote work environments.
Zscaler Zero Trust Exchange provides secure, adaptive connectivity without traditional VPNs, allowing organizations to replace legacy systems and bolster remote work security. The platform offers cloud-based protection, single sign-on, dynamic URL categorization, and scalable solutions. While advanced security features like DLP and threat protection enhance data protection, users may face issues with speed, connectivity, and some customization options. Integration challenges, latency due to multi-tenant hosting, reporting delays, and licensing costs require consideration. It supports secure internet access and private application security, ensuring traffic control and data compliance.
